hopeful
МаглыТип контенту
Профили
Форум
Календарь
Все, що було написано hopeful
-
Частое корректное завершение работы демона SG
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
1. С корректными перезагрузками SG разобрался. Мой косяк. Скрипт контроля на живость SG иногда работал неправильно и перезагружал SG. 2. Вопрос по ненормальным завершениям работы остается. Как поймать систему и выяснить почему это происходит? 3. Что значат записи в логах: Shutting down ... 15 Shutting down ... 20 ? -
Частое корректное завершение работы демона SG
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
По логам: В случае нормального выхода рисует: Shutting down... 20 TRAFFCOUNTER::Stop Stopped. Main loop exit В случае просто вылета в логах, как и положено, нет ничего ... :-) Все, что мог предоставил. Помогите, плиз, решить задачку ... -
Частое корректное завершение работы демона SG
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
Случай с пустыми файлами stat был, но насколько я понял это следствие неправильного завершения работы SG (я прав?), и действительно, если stat пустой, SG после этого нормально не стартует. К предыдущему посту. Вариант ненормального завершения работы SG абсолютно аналогичен, если первому процессу дать kill -9 -
Частое корректное завершение работы демона SG
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
В дополнение. В FreeBSD у SG в нормальном состоянии два процесса. Если смотреть ps-ом - первый со статусом S<s, второй - S< - при активности пользователей и I< - при неактивности. При ненормальном завершении работы SG остается только второй процесс в состоянии I<. -
Частое корректное завершение работы демона SG
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
1. Полный номер версии сервера - 2.016.7.6 2. Фрагмент лога чуть позже, когда буду на работе :-). 3. Нагрузку при отрубании точно сказать не могу, т.к. не могу предсказать момент отрубания (если подскажете как - буду благодарен). При нормальном режиме работы загрузка процессора 5-7%, шлюз обеспечивает раздачу Инет для группы пользователей 30 чел, скорость внешнего канала 2МБит. 4. Pentium III 600 Mhz, материна Acorp, чипсет VIA, 128 RAM, 40G HDD. -
FreeBSD 5.4, SG последний (Rel. can. 3), expat 1.95.8, все поставлено по инструкции. Несколько раз на дню SG ни с того ни с сего, иногда корректно, иногда не очень завершает работу, отключает пользователей. По статистике чаще отключения происходят при интенсивной работе пользователей. Загрузка ресурсов компа небольшая. 1. Подскажите куда копать, плиз. 2. При компиляции (make bsd5) есть предупреждения: Parser.cpp:235 warning: long unsined int fomat, time_t arg (arg 3) 271: long int format, time_t (arg 3) 274: long int format, time_t (arg 3) 277: long int format,
-
OnConect/Disconnect и всегда OnLine
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
Очень интерестно .... 1. А как в этом случае идет авторизация, только по IP, и пароль пользователю прописывать не нужно? 2. А если я ввел нового пользователя и демон уже работает, как открыть этому пользователю инет, и аналогично, если денег и МБ уже нет, как закрыть? 3. Есть ли способ для определеных пользователей не выполнять скрипты, чтобы они всегда были допущены к Интету и трафик для них считался? -
Если в настройке пользователя стоит галка "Всегда OnLine", для него скрипты OnConnect и OnDisconect все равно выполняются?
-
Как вычислить, какой процесс в системе приводит к оставновке SG? В логе записи: Shutting down ... 15 TRAFFCOUNTER::Stop Shutting down ... 20 TRAFFCOUNTER::Stop Stopped. Stopped. User xxx disconnected.
-
О конфигураторе (1.60.7) но немного из другой оперы. Если внести нового пользователя и не проставлять в поле IP ничего, в конфиг пользователя в поле IP не заносится *. Если в этот момент перестартовать SG, - он не запустится с ошибкой по поводу IP пользователя. * автоматически проставляется только при изменении пользователя.
-
Перекомпилил expat с префиксом /usr, поставил 2.16 сервер, завтра потестирую, если больше не появлюсь - значит сработало .... :0) Еще раз спасибо.
-
Да, разумеется, ошибся. Спасибо.
-
Хорошо, а для перехода с версии сервера 2.014 к 2.016, я могу сдлеать: > killall stargazer > make bcd5 а потом, не делая make install, просто скопировать бинарник из каталога инсталляции в /sbin, для сохранения ранее введенных тарифов и пользователей? Или другой путь?
-
Ну хорошо :-) Попробую перставить expat. И все таки, если можно ответить на 2 и 3 вопрос из шапки, плиз ...
-
Установка экспата на BSD - это 6 файлов, т.к. у меня экспат был установлен с путем по умолчанию - я сделал 6 символьных ссылок по нужным SG путям. На вирт. машине все прекрасно работает именно в таком варианте. Может все таки дело в другом?
-
Роутер на 2 интерфейса, FreeBSD 5.3, expat 1.95.8, NAT, ipfilter, Celeron 633/128M. (Так как expat был установлен ранее по стандартному пути, просто сделал несколько символьных ссылок, чтобы SG скомпилился и установился без ошибок). SG сервер 2.016 (2.014 - тоже пробовал), конфигуратор 1.60.7. В системе два процесса SG один со статусом S<s, второй - S< (при работе пользователей). Клиент XPSP2, firewall отключен. ---------------------------------- Пока ничего не делаешь конфигуратором все работает долго и устойчиво. Как только пытаешься сохранить изменения в тарифах или в пользовател
-
Может не в тему, но очень всем благодарен за быструю реакцию по ответам на вопросы. Это еще одна составляющая хорошего продукта.
-
Действительно, о простом-то и не подумал :-)
-
Попробовал реализовать прозрачное проксирование на Squid + SG. Работает, хотя точность подсчета трафика проверить не могу. Вопрос по настройке учета HTTP - трафика. Допустим, внутренний интерфейс роутера со всей начинкой 10.3.3.250. Прописываем всю сеть 10.3.3.0/24 в рулесах как внутреннюю. Пока в обозревателях пользователя НЕ настроен прокси - все красиво. HTTP запросы идут на шлюз по умолчанию (наш роутер), он форвардит порт x.x.x.80 на 127.0.0.1:3128 (squid) не изменяя адрес назначения пакета, и трафик нормально считается, разделяясь на местный и прочий. Но если пользователь в настройках об
-
Проверил сам. С помомощью newsyslog все работает. Достаточно в /etc/newsyslog.conf стандартно прописать строчку примерно так: /var/log/stargazer.log 600 5 100 * J
-
Виноват, syslogd немного из другой оперы )) В целом вопрос для FreeBSD актуален. Нужно ли посылать сигнал процессу, что журнал ротирован? Нужно ли перезапускать SG после ротирования?
-
Можно ли организовать ротацию журнала stargazer.log стандартными для FereBSD средствами (демон syslod) и что нужно прописать в /etc/newsyslog.conf ?
-
Автоначисление денег пользователю
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
Кстати, если по ошибке запускаешь демона SG второй раз, он в принципе запускается, порождая еще один процесс. Пожелание разработчикам контролировать эту ситуацию и хотя бы предупреждать, что процесс SG уже запущен. -
Если не трудно - поделитесь скриптом для проверки рабочего состояния процесса и его перезапуска. Спасибо )
-
Автоначисление денег пользователю
тема ответил в hopeful пользователя hopeful в Питання по Stargazer
4. Можно ли заставить SG слушать только определенный интерфейс для администрирования и авторизации?